Zac Gallen’s Pitching Brilliance Falls Short in World Series Game 5 Loss

Phoenix, AZ — In a tense battle to keep their World Series hopes alive, Arizona Diamondbacks starting pitcher Zac Gallen delivered a pitching performance that showcased his brilliance on the mound. Gallen took the stage on Wednesday, facing off against the Texas Rangers in Game 5 of the 2023 World Series.

Gallen started the game strong, retiring the first 14 batters he faced without allowing a hit. He seemed to be on track for a perfect game, adding to the tension and excitement of the moment. Unfortunately, Gallen’s pursuit of perfection was halted when he issued a walk to Nathaniel Lowe in the fifth inning. Later in the seventh inning, the Rangers managed to break through with a Corey Seager hit that ended Gallen’s no-hit bid.

Despite the eventual 5-0 loss, Gallen’s performance gave the Diamondbacks every opportunity to extend the series. Manager Torey Lovullo praised Gallen’s determination, stating, He came out fighting. I knew that Zac was going to be our starting pitcher, and I felt really good about it. I know what’s inside of him. I know where his heart is. And he didn’t let us down.

Gallen’s final line for the night showcased his pitching prowess, with 6.1 innings pitched and only one run allowed on three hits. He successfully bridged the gap to the back end of the bullpen, receiving a well-deserved ovation from the sold-out Chase Field crowd as he left the mound for the final time in 2023.

While Gallen’s exceptional performance should be celebrated, the Diamondbacks struggled to capitalize on scoring opportunities throughout the game. They finished 0-for-9 with runners in scoring position, contrasting with the Rangers’ 3-for-10 and four-run outburst in the ninth inning. These missed opportunities ultimately decided the outcome of the game.

Gallen’s remarkable year in MLB solidified his status as an ace. He set career highs in multiple categories, including starts, innings pitched, fWAR, and strikeouts. His inclusion in the All-Star Game, where he started for the National League, further cemented his credentials. Although Gallen faced challenges in the postseason, with the Diamondbacks losing his last three outings, his performance in Game 5 presented a stark contrast. From the first pitch, Gallen’s dominance was evident as he effectively stifled the Rangers’ offense.
